"Jumper" is a song by Dutch DJs Hardwell and W&W.

Background

Hardwell premiered the song at the 2013 Ultra Music Festival during his set in Miami. [3]

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Hardwell</span> Dutch DJ and music producer

Robbert van de Corput, known professionally as Hardwell, is a Dutch DJ and music producer from Breda. He was voted the world's number one DJ by DJ Mag in 2013 and again in 2014. In 2022, he was ranked at number 43 in the top 100 DJs poll by DJ Mag. He is best known for his sets at music festivals, including Ultra Music Festival, Sunburn and Tomorrowland.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">W&W</span> Dutch DJ duo

W&W is a Dutch DJ and record production duo composed of Willem van Hanegem Jr. and Wardt van der Harst. They began their careers by producing trance music, before venturing into big room house and other forms of EDM.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Spaceman (Hardwell song)</span>

"Spaceman" is a single by Dutch DJ and record producer Hardwell. It was released for digital download on 23 January 2012. A second version called "Call Me a Spaceman" featuring vocals by Dutch singer Mitch Crown and was released on 18 May 2012. Another vocal version was created in collaboration with Bright Lights. Despite Hardwell claiming that the latter was his favorite, his management decided to rather release "Call Me a Spaceman". Titled as "Mr. Spaceman" Bright Lights offered the track as a free download in late 2015. For "Spaceman"'s five-years anniversary he released the remastered Bright Lights version as "Mr. Spaceman ".
